1. art. 1 of the Law of 20 February 1958, No 75, are added at the end, the following paragraphs: "Anyone who engages in prostitution or advocates the use in public places or open to the public and 'punished by imprisonment from five to fifteen days and a fine of from two hundred to three thousand euro. the same penalty in the second paragraph is subject anyone in a public place or open to the public relies on the sexual services of persons engaged in prostitution or contracted ... Since 1999, the priming was no longer a crime, provided it would involve children, but simple administrative offense. Which meant GIA 'a fine.
exploitation of prostitution was also GIA 'considered a crime.
Basically Carfagna has reintroduced the so senseless crime of soliciting. The only new thing (so to speak) is the penalty and the imprisonment of the customer.
